Oh, and to answer the question about whether or not seeing your downrigger ball in the FF affects what you see below, the answer is: yes, it probably does. However, remember that the sonar's signal is an inverted cone which gets wider and wider the deeper you go. The downrigger ball is something like 3-4" in diameter and so represents only a tiny part of the return signal.
Take a look at this picture from my sonar in which I had two downriggers out (these are the horizontal lines):
as you can see, there were plenty of fish below the downrigger ball that were still identified. You may also want to check out Lowrance's sonar tutorial:
